Definitions:

Corpus Callosum

A large band of nerve fibers connecting the two hemispheres of the brain, facilitating communication and coordination between them.

Experiential Factors

Elements and influences arising from personal experiences that shape an individual's development, behaviors, and perceptions.

Biological Factors

Genetic, neurological, and physical conditions that affect human behavior and physical health.

Gender Constancy

The understanding that one's gender is fixed and does not change over time, typically developed by age 6 or 7.
